Output 2e63b4ab83850c1dab8a0e598543d793deb46033e20db23c44d53ead84b1475d:1

value
30109647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a596448030fcf7f6658dba79b630a746b1c39f8 OP_EQUAL
address
MG8t8jvFPf4EBddrL4gYfpxA19Z3bEUSXb
transaction
2e63b4ab83850c1dab8a0e598543d793deb46033e20db23c44d53ead84b1475d
spent
true